If you can find female Bettas that have already been living together, that's best.

Odd numbers do not magically make them ok together. That's a fable.

If you have a local Betta or Aquarium club you may be able to get young sisters to raise together.

Betta Sororities work for some. We tried it at my store. We added a group of females to a 10g. Ended up with dead and dying females.

I would do a heavily planted tank with some floating plants as well as some rocks and driftwood.

Adding Catalpa ( Indian Almond) leaves will help the Bettas also.
